Aquaculture training at UHI Shetland

Shetland Seawater (15) UHI 27jun25

UHI Shetland offers a comprehensive suite of aquaculture courses tailored to industry needs – from short skills courses and apprenticeships to online CPD (continuing professional development) in sustainable aquaculture management. Training is flexible and often delivered directly at employers’ sites. Key topics include fish health, welfare, biosecurity and RAS (recirculating aquaculture systems) water quality. Apprenticeships cover all experience levels, while online CPD supports professionals aiming to meet climate and sustainability targets. With modern facilities and a strong industry focus, UHI Shetland plays a vital role in preparing the aquaculture workforce across Shetland, Scotland and beyond.
